Description
VanEck Australian Banks ETF is an exchange-traded fund that offers investors focused exposure to the Australian banking sector by holding a diversified portfolio of Australian Securities Exchange (ASX)-listed bank stocks. Its primary objective is to replicate, before fees and expenses, the performance of the MVIS Australia Banks Index, which comprises the most liquid banking companies that derive at least half of their revenue or assets from Australian banking activities. This structure helps to reduce the risk associated with investing in a single bank and instead provides broad access to all major Australian banks in one trade.
The fund operates using a passive management style, employing physical replication to track its underlying index. By targeting the banking sector, it gives investors the opportunity to gain tactical exposure to one of the central pillars of Australia’s economy, known for its strong regulatory environment and significant market capitalization within the national equity market. VanEck Australian Banks ETF is also characterized by quarterly distributions, often with high franking credits, reflecting the substantial dividend yields historically associated with Australia's major banks. It serves as a sector-specific tool for investors seeking income and capital performance in line with the country’s banking industry.
